INCY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

810 of the 8,128 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Incyte (INCY)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$19.2B — down 3.5% from $19.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 108 funds opened new INCY positions and 102 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 318 added to existing stakes and 288 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$252M. The largest seller was Dodge & Cox, cutting an estimated $101M.
